I missed it. Looks good. But why such a high lip mount? How does that effect the action compared with a standard setup?
swins great on a fast retreve it will dive around 6 to 8 foot and on a slow to steadt it will be just under the surface or making a killer v wake with the butt wantin to breat the surface .

the plug it selph has a great side to side wiggle and a verryyyyyy small roll to it .
